DATA Reshape for WooCommerce is a bridge between your WooCommerce store and the DATA Reshape platform. It emits structured ecommerce events (product_viewed, product_added_to_cart, cart_viewed, checkout_started, checkout_completed, plus the mid-funnel checkout steps) into DATA Reshape’s reshape.push() queue, and DATA Reshape’s loader — served from a tracking subdomain you control — handles delivery and routing onward to GA4, Meta, TikTok, and every other destination you have connected.
Because the loader is served first-party, events are not blocked by ad blockers, ITP, or the usual third-party-script defences that break conventional gtag/fbq/ttq setups. You do not need to fire those calls in parallel — DATA Reshape routes a single event to every connected destination with the correct platform-specific name and field mapping.
This plugin does not replace analytics tools like Google Analytics or Meta Pixel; it replaces the fragile transport layer underneath them. Event processing, routing, and deduplication all happen inside DATA Reshape.
An active DATA Reshape plan is required to use this plugin. All tracking logic, integrations, and event delivery are managed through the DATA Reshape platform.
What’s coming next: API Events
A second tab in the settings UI (“API Events”) is reserved for data that can’t flow through the storefront browser at all — admin-recorded phone-call orders, sales agent activity, and historical customer/order backfill imported into DATA Reshape via API. This is not a CAPI-style server-side mirror of the browser events (those already get through reliably thanks to the first-party loader); it covers genuinely different data sources. Configuration UI is dormant in this version and will be wired up in a later release.
Features
Core Features
Global enable/disable for the integration
DATA Reshape library integration
Subdomain tracking support
Fully compatible with WooCommerce HPOS (High-Performance Order Storage)
Events
Product Viewed
Product Added to Cart (AJAX + POST + GET fallbacks)
Product Removed from Cart
Cart Viewed
Checkout Started
Checkout Steps (Billing Address Added, Shipping Detail Added, Payment Method Selected — legacy checkout only)
Checkout Completed
Consent integration — DATA Reshape natively detects most CMPs (Cookiebot, OneTrust, Termly, etc.) and Google Consent Mode v2, with no plugin-side wiring required
Single “Grant consent by default” toggle for stores that don’t run a CMP — fires DATA Reshape’s native consent_updated push at session start so events process immediately
drswc_consent_payload filter for stores that want to drive the consent object explicitly from PHP
Plain user data in reshape payloads (DATA Reshape hashes server-side)
Advanced Tracking
Spec-shaped products with price_base + price; tax_included / tax_percent only when WooCommerce tax is enabled
Variations carry parent_id / parent_name / parent_sku / parent_url
Order-level and product-level coupons emitted in dedicated coupons[] arrays
Shipping methods and payment methods emitted as structured arrays on Checkout Completed
Categories emitted as both category (primary) and categories[] with name+id
Stock status, product type, creation timestamp, image, and gallery images
Extensibility
drswc_event_payload — filter the full event envelope before push
drswc_product_payload — inject GTIN/MPN/EAN, predicted values, custom properties per product
drswc_user_payload — augment user identity (pre_purchase or purchase source)
drswc_consent_payload — replace or inject the consent object
Reliability Enhancements
Handles non-AJAX add-to-cart flows
Handles redirect-based add-to-cart (?add-to-cart=)
Cache-safe identity hydration — PII never inlined into cacheable HTML
Sticky user identity model (loader caches first-seen user, subsequent events inherit)
Safe execution timing for low overhead
Configuration
Integration Setup
Enable Integration (master switch)
Tracking Subdomain (the first-party host serving DATA Reshape’s loader)
Library ID
Built-in “Check tracking endpoint” health check
Events
Master switch for browser-delivered events
Per-event toggles (so events you handle via custom code can be disabled individually)
“Grant consent by default” toggle — off by default (let DATA Reshape auto-detect your CMP / Google Consent Mode); on if you don’t run a CMP and want events processed immediately
API Events
Reserved for the upcoming admin-recorded events sync (phone-call orders, etc.) and historical customer/order backfill. Not yet active.
